Write an algebraic expression to represent the area of the triangle (Area = 1/2 ×base ×height) given that the length is 6 inches

greater than the height. Then evaluate it to find the area when h=7 inches​

The expression for area of triangle is 1/2x² + 3x.

<h3>What is Algebra?</h3>

A branch of mathematics known as algebra deals with symbols and the mathematical operations performed on them.

Variables are the name given to these symbols because they lack set values.

In order to determine the values, these symbols are also subjected to various addition, subtraction, multiplication, and division arithmetic operations.

Given:

Area = 1/2 × base × height

and, length is 6 inches greater than the height.

let the height of the triangle is x

length of triangle = x + 6

So, The Area of triangle

= 1/2 x base x height

= 1/2(x)(x+ 6)

= 1/2x² + 3x

Hence, the expression for area of triangle is 1/2x² + 3x.
